Output 650caa4ca80f6dbf641baad4208b3d435a1eef979750e00c8a0c9317bf97acd8:11

value
688000
script pubkey
OP_0 OP_PUSHBYTES_20 8f848669743c5a221cc2fd1f8dcfce8f5f426d2b
address
bc1q37zgv6t583dzy8xzl50cmn7w3a05ymft3ale9y
transaction
650caa4ca80f6dbf641baad4208b3d435a1eef979750e00c8a0c9317bf97acd8
confirmations
183804
spent
true